Post-July 4 Fireworks: Cyber Security, Critical Infrastructure Debates Re-Ignite

Overview United States critical infrastructure and cyber space security protections - with Internet communications clearly playing a key role in both cases - intermingled and flared up in the first week of July, 2006 as increasingly debated policy issues that the federal government, business enterprises and industrialists must try to resolve. Congressional, law-enforcement, intelligence and e-commerce transaction companies have expressed a growing concern over the high vulnerability of information via online transactions as well as through hacking into Internet databases. Instances involving the theft of information regarding U.S. veterans and active military personnel also underscore and highlight such threats.
